But, we\u2019ve also been known to spend a complete week working on a three-second transition\u2026\u201d<\/p>\n<p>\u201c\u2026Or throwing out a couple minutes of music we\u2019ve worked on because it doesn\u2019t fit with the parts before or after it,\u201d said guitarist St\u00e9phane Simard.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cOn <em>Nurture<\/em>, we took a different direction during the writing,\u201d Jean-Daniel Villeneuve continued, \u201cto make it more articulate and instrumental. Death metal wasn\u2019t our only guideline for writing music or even what we enjoy; we like jazz, old prog from the 70s, classical and we want to play the well-crafted music that we want to hear.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>Thematically, <em>Nurture<\/em> uses \u201cveiled lyrical references and far-reaching metaphors in the exploration of human experience commonalities,\u201d according to a press release. The lyrics to the effort were written by bassist Philippe Cimon. \u201cThere isn\u2019t a central theme for the lyrics on Nurture,\u201d Philippe Cimon observed. \u201cThe songs were written over a certain period of time and different themes are explored. A common aspect to every song is the use of esoteric or mythological references to express a relation to a certain theme, be it substance abuse, trauma and its consequences, faith, solitude, or man\u2019s lust for power. However, the themes are sometimes brought up in a way that is very unclear and lets the reader make up his own explanation of the text.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>\u201cThere\u2019s no gory stuff or anything typically death metal in our lyrics,\u201d added Villeneuve. \u201cOur goal is to have the listener be able to associate a lyrical idea to a song. We want the listener to create their own feeling and meaning for the songs. It\u2019s an album where people can really feel the vibe throughout the whole thing, not just from listening to one song. There\u2019s an energy you can feel from our effort and there\u2019s a flow that goes from beginning to the end, a journey that\u2019s speaking in the music.\u201d<\/p>\n<p><em>Nurture<\/em> was recorded at La Boite Noire, with David Lizotte  overseeing the recording of the vocals.
